10 Engaging Fun Activities to Try with Your Family
Contents (12 sections)

Family time can be the most cherished time of all, particularly when you’re engaging in fun activities that bring everyone closer together. Here’s a comprehensive guide to ten engaging fun activities that you can try with your family, promoting bonding, learning, and lots of laughter along the way.

1. Outdoor Treasure Hunt

Nothing beats the thrill of a treasure hunt! Create a map or a list of clues that lead to hidden treasures around your garden or local park. You can hide small treats or toys at various locations and encourage your family members to work together to find them. According to a study conducted by the National Trust, outdoor activities strengthen family bonds and improve mental well-being. A treasure hunt promotes teamwork, critical thinking, and it’s a fantastic way to enjoy nature together.

2. Family Game Night

Set aside one evening a week for a family game night. Dust off those old board games or delve into some new ones that have been released recently. From classics like Monopoly to contemporary games such as Dixit or Codenames, there’s something for everyone. According to the American Psychological Association, playing games can enhance problem-solving skills and promote family interaction. Make it even more exciting by introducing themes or prizes for the winners!

3. Cooking Together

Turn mealtime into a fun family activity by cooking together. Choose recipes that allow each family member to have a role, whether it’s chopping vegetables, stirring sauces, or setting the table. Cooking nurtures cooperation and gives everyone the opportunity to learn a valuable life skill. A study from Harvard University found that cooking as a family can improve communication skills and boost a sense of belonging. Plus, you get to enjoy delicious food at the end!

4. DIY Craft Day

Unleash your creativity with a DIY crafts day! Gather supplies you already have at home, like paper, old clothes, and craft tools, and let your imagination run wild. You can create greeting cards, paint old furniture, or even make homemade gifts. Engaging in crafts can significantly enhance fine motor skills, which is especially beneficial for younger family members. You can find many ideas and guides online, making it easy to organise a fun-filled DIY craft day.

5. Visit Local Attractions

Take the time to explore local attractions that you may not have visited yet. This could be a museum, an amusement park, or a local historical site. These outings provide an excellent opportunity for learning and serve to enhance appreciation for your community. According to VisitBritain, family outings can significantly improve familial relationships and create lasting memories. Make a checklist of places you'd all like to visit and start ticking them off together.

6. Host an Outdoor Movie Night

Bring the cinema experience to your backyard by organising an outdoor movie night. Set up a projector, lay out blankets and cushions, and prepare popcorn for everyone. Choose a family-friendly movie that appeals to all ages. Outdoor movie nights create a magical ambience and bring a sense of togetherness that is often lacking with typical indoor movie experiences. This activity can also create opportunities for discussions about the film afterwards, enhancing communication.

7. Gardening as a Team

Get your family outdoors and engaged with nature by starting a small garden. Whether it’s flowers, vegetables or herbs, gardening is a hands-on activity that every family member can partake in. It nurtures responsibility and teaches children the importance of taking care of living things. Plus, it’s a chance to discuss the environment and the benefits of home gardening, aligning with findings from the Royal Horticultural Society that gardening promotes mental health and well-being.

8. Weekly Family Read-aloud

Create a reading ritual with your family. Choose a book that everyone can enjoy and take turns reading aloud. This activity not only promotes literacy but can also spark meaningful discussions. Experts from Reading Rockets have indicated that group reading sessions foster a love for literature among children and create cherished family traditions. You can pair this with themed snacks or activities based on the storyline to make it even more engaging.

9. Plan a Mini Sports Day

Set up a mini sports day in your garden or local park. Include activities like sack races, three-legged races, and a relay race. This promotes physical fitness and teamwork while ensuring loads of laughter. Research from the World Health Organization suggests that engaging in sports together increases family bonding and promotes a healthy lifestyle. Create trophies or certificates for the winners to enhance the competitive spirit!

10. Volunteer Together

Get involved in your community by volunteering as a family. Whether it's helping at a local food bank, animal shelter, or participating in community clean-ups, volunteering allows family members to contribute positively to society while learning about empathy and giving back. According to the National Corporation for Community Service, family volunteering enhances interpersonal relationships and fosters a greater sense of gratitude among family members.
